应用DTBIA技术快速检测柑橘黄龙病菌研究

摘  要:
柑橘黄龙病病原菌为韧皮部限制性寄生菌Candidatus Liberibacter,迄今为止尚未成功获得离体纯培养。因此基于特异性抗体的高通量血清学检测技术迄今尚未开发。本实验室前期研究利用异源表达重组黄龙病菌外膜蛋白Omp_(CLas)免疫动物,制备并获得了特异性多克隆抗体(Anti-Omp_(CLas)-Pab)。本研究利用直接组织印迹免疫法(Direct tissue blot immunoassay,DTBIA)技术对获得的多克隆抗体的检测效果进行了初步评价,证实该抗体可以特异性识别中国不同地理来源的柑橘黄龙病菌分离物;柑橘叶柄、叶片中脉、枝条、根部、果梗和种子中均存在黄龙病菌,其中根部和种子中的病菌含量相对较低,枝条和叶片中脉中的含量较高。该多克隆抗体的获得为后续快速检测试剂盒或试纸条的研发奠定了基础。

摘  要:
Citrus Huanglongbing(HLB)is caused by phloem-limited bacteria named Candidatus Liberibacters. Up to date,despite of all kinds of efforts to get pure culture,HLB bacteria still resist in vitro growth. Fast detection especially the high-throughput methods based on the specificity of serological methods has not yet been developed. In our previous work,we constructed fusion OmpCLas protein and heterogonous expressed to get antigen to produce corresponding polyclonal antibody(Pab). In the present study,we carried out experiment on the assessment of the detection efficiency of Anti-OmpCLas-Pab antibody with direct tissue blot immunoassay( DTIBA). Citrus samples collected from different geographical regions were tested. Different organs of petiole,midrib,stem,root,peduncale and seeds were all analyzed. Detection efficiency of both DTBIA and PCR were compared. Our result indicated:AntiOmpCLas-Pab could specifically recognize HLB bacteria in different isolates originated from different geographical areas in China,including samples from Jiangxi,Fujian,Yunnan,Guangdong and Hainan provinces. Tests with different tissues of petiole,leaf mid rib,stem,root,peduncale and seeds revealed the presence of HLB bacteria. However,less HLB bacteria were found in roots and seeds;higher titer was found in leaf mid-ribs and stems. Our results indicated that Anti-OmpCLas-Pab is a promising antibody for the fast detection of HLB bacteria which laid a basic foundation for the product development on the fast detection kits and dipsticks.
